Richard Corrigan: Christmas Cook-a-long


Richard Corrigan will be cooking live on Tuesday (tomorrow) a complete Christmas Dinner....and you can call in with questions. Selected viewers will cook a long Richard in their own homes. This concept was quite successful with Gordon Ramsay and it is highly entertaining. The show will be broadcasted in 2 parts starting at 7pm on RTE1 and again at 8:30.

'Live from Farmleigh House in the Phoenix Park, Richard Corrigan - with the help of Mary Kennedy - cooks the perfect Christmas dinner in real time. The show will be transmitted live in two sections, 19:00-19:30 and 20:30-21:00. The Meath master chef will interact live with the audience at home, allowing viewers to participate with their questions about this once-a-year culinary challenge. The show will also feature festive choral music.'
